Overview

["The PW13 is built cordless from the ground up, with a 4000mAh battery meant to power the pump for stretches without a recharge. That's the main selling point here: no cord to route or trip over, so it can go in spots a corded fountain can't, like the center of a room or a closet shelf.", 'It holds 74 ounces, or about 2.2 liters, which is a fairly standard size for a single-cat fountain. The listing highlights a proprietary SilentFlow pump built into the unit and a BPA-free build for the water-contact parts.', "At just under 20 dollars, it's priced in line with corded budget fountains despite the added cordless hardware, and it's already pulled in over 700 ratings at a 4.4 average in a short time on the market."]

Performance notes

The integrated SilentFlow pump is the headline spec, aimed at cats who are put off by the whirring of a typical fountain motor. Because it runs on battery rather than a wall cord, expect to check charge levels periodically rather than treating it as a plug-and-forget appliance.

Frequently asked questions

How long does the battery last on a charge?

It runs on a 4000mAh battery, which is sized for multi-day cordless use, though actual runtime depends on how continuously the pump cycles and how often your cat visits.

Can I use it plugged in instead of on battery?

It's built as a cordless, battery-operated fountain, so cordless use is the intended setup rather than an add-on feature.

Is it loud when the pump runs?

It uses what the brand calls an integrated SilentFlow pump aimed at quiet operation, which is worth checking against your own cat's sensitivity to fountain noise.
